To install the communication interface, proceed as follows:
1. Insert the communication cable of the interface into the last available hollowed out section of
the internal rubber insert.
Make sure the cable is long enough to reach from the housing opening to the desired "ComOut"
connection socket on the circuit board of the Sunny Backup 2200.
2. Pull the communication cable into the housing from the outside.
3. Insert the RJ45 plug of the communication cable into the "ComOut" connection socket on the
Sunny Backup 2200. The plug will audibly snap into place.
4. Re-assemble the feed-through element and insert it in the installation opening on the base of the
Sunny Backup 2200 housing.
5. Connect the other end of the
communication cable on the
communication device.
The installation guide of the communication
device specifies which three pins should be
connected.
The following table shows the assignment of
these pins to the corresponding pins of the
RJ45 socket.
WebBox pin assignment
2
7
5
6. Terminate the Sunny Backup 2200 at RS485.
In the Sunny Backup 2200, the RS485 data bus is terminated using a plug. This plug is already
pre-installed in the Sunny Backup 2200. Please only remove the plug if you want to connect
another communication device.
7. Plug the communication interface into the socket on the board.
The Sunny Backup 2200 can use various data transmission speeds (1200 to 19200 bps) to
communicate with external devices. To allow such communication, the "250.06 ComBaud"
parameter must be set accordingly.
